Bio: Kristin Huffman was a lead in the Tony award winning Broadway musical by Stephen Sondheim, ”Company” She is the Artistic Director of the professional theatre: The New Paradigm Theatre, www.nptheatre.org and has a career that has spanned over 20 years professionally performing with operas, theatres, Broadway and symphonies around the US/Europe.

As a former Miss Ohio/Runner-up to Miss America she continues hosting and producing charity events as well as judging international voice and acting competitions.

She teaches at the University of Hartford and in Milford and consistently connects her students to industry professionals as well as provides performing opportunities with Broadway, film and tv stars through her professional theatre company. She graduated Summa Cum Laude from both Capital University Conservatory of Music BM (Music ed: flute and voice concentration) and Northwestern University (Masters of Music- Opera)
